20 inch OLED-TV Panel from Samsung Electronics in 2009?
Samsung Electronics has joined the trend by establishing the test line for AM OLED television panels with the mass production date slated for 2009.
As previously declared, we will focus on the 20-inch AM OLED panel. The test line aims to review the possibility in the larger size panel before the mass production,’’ a spokesperson from Samsung Electronics said.
At the CES-2008 Samsung shows us a 14.1-and 31-inch organic light-emitting diode (OLED) TVs.
Dr. Jongwoo Park, president of Digital Media business, Samsung Electronics commented that OLED is seen as a contender to be at the center of the future display market mainstream given its very high resolution, and light weight.
